Director Of Rcm & Personal Care

The Director of RCM & Personal Care will own the long-term product vision and business outcomes for RCM platform capabilities that support billing, claims, collections, payer connectivity, clearinghouse integrations, automation, and scalable technical architecture and the strategy and roadmap for HCHB Personal Care, including scheduling, caregiver time and task management, EVV compliance, authorization management, utilization visibility, and reimbursement workflows.

This role requires a strategic product leader who can operate across customer needs, market dynamics, regulatory requirements, business objectives, and technical delivery.

The Director will partner closely with Engineering, Architecture, UX, Operations, Sales, Implementation, Customer Success, Support, and executive leadership to define priorities, align stakeholders, and deliver measurable value. This leader will be expected to shape the roadmap, influence investment decisions, guide product managers and cross-functional teams, and drive modernization through API-first capabilities, automation, AI/ML-enabled experiences, and resilient platform design.

Platform Strategy & Product Ownership

  • Lead the product strategy, roadmap, and execution for HCHB's Revenue Cycle Platform, with accountability for platform capabilities that support billing, claims, collections, payer connectivity, clearinghouse integrations, and revenue cycle operations.
  • Lead the product strategy, roadmap, and business outcomes for HCHB Personal Care applications, with accountability for capabilities supporting scheduling, caregiver time and task management, EVV compliance, authorization management, utilization visibility, reauthorization workflows, and multiple reimbursement models.
  • Own and advance the application and platform workstream in alignment with company priorities, customer needs, technical architecture, and measurable business outcomes.
  • Drive modernization of the platform through modular services, API-first design, configurable workflows, partner tooling, automation, AI-assisted workflows, and scalable platform architecture.
  • Define and prioritize capabilities that improve cash acceleration, reduce denials, lower days sales outstanding, increase first-pass resolution, improve billing team productivity, and strengthen compliance readiness.
  • Lead discovery and solutioning for end-to-end revenue workflows, including charge capture, claims creation and submission, edits and scrubbing, payer rules, eligibility and benefits, prior authorization support, remittance and ERA posting, denials and appeals, patient responsibility, reconciliation, and audit readiness.
  • Apply deep understanding of post-acute operations, including Home Health, Hospice, and Personal Care/EVV, to ensure RCM capabilities account for clinical documentation, visit verification, payer rules, regulatory requirements, and reimbursement complexity.
  • Establish, monitor, and communicate success metrics, including claim acceptance rates, denial rates, remittance posting accuracy, throughput, cycle times, user adoption, operational efficiency, and customer satisfaction.
  • Balance near-term delivery needs with long-term platform scalability, maintainability, security, performance, observability, and reliability.
